The circumference of a circle is a mathematical phenomenon that the n-polygon is inscribed in a circle, the side length is set to an, and the circumference of a regular n-polygon is n*an. When n is increasing, the perimeter of a regular polygon approaches the perimeter of a circle, that is, n approaches infinity, and C=n*an.

The formula of circular area is a theorem. Is the square of pi * radius, which can be expressed in letters as: S=πr? Or S=π*(d/2)? . (π stands for pi, r stands for radius and d stands for diameter).

Pi is the ratio of the circumference to the diameter of a circle, which is generally expressed by the Greek letter π and is a universal mathematical constant in mathematics and physics. π is also equal to the ratio of the area of a circle to the square of its radius.
